Constructor

GtkImagenew_from_pixbuf

Declaration [src]

GtkWidget*
gtk_image_new_from_pixbuf (
  GdkPixbuf* pixbuf
)

Description [src]

Creates a new GtkImage displaying pixbuf. The GtkImage does not assume a reference to the pixbuf; you still need to unref it if you own references. GtkImage will add its own reference rather than adopting yours.

Note that this function just creates an GtkImage from the pixbuf. The GtkImage created will not react to state changes. Should you want that, you should use gtk_image_new_from_icon_name().

Parameters

pixbuf

Type: GdkPixbuf

A GdkPixbuf, or NULL.

The argument can be NULL.
The data is owned by the caller of the function.

Return value

Type: GtkWidget

A new GtkImage.

The data is owned by the called function.